All plugins that accept image uploads must route files through the shared Pictonery scrub step before any storage or forwarding. Verify that GPS coordinates, device serials, and embedded thumbnails are stripped, and that scrubbing occurs server-side even when a client claims pre-processing. Plugins performing their own scrubbing must submit sample output for verification; self-attestation alone does not pass this item. Evidence and exception requests should be sent to the auditor named below.

account owner for bawip-tahag: Raleth Quenok

Subject: Partner SFTP drop — good to go

Hey release folks — the nightly drop to the Bramblehurst partner SFTP endpoint went through fine after yesterday's hiccup. Retry logic in the Cartwheel exporter seems to have fixed the truncated manifests. Nothing blocking the cut tonight as far as I can see. The transfer's trace reference is below.

build token for kagaf-hahof: htk14_9d3d4d26d7d8de

# Haulwick Fuel Report — Environments

The fleet fuel-usage report runs in three environments: dev, staging, and prod. Each pulls telemetry from its own ingest bucket and writes weekly summaries to the reporting warehouse. Staging mirrors prod schemas but uses a two-truck sample fleet. For this week's sync, note that prod operates with the values below.

deployment values, fafog-fawip:
[jorox]
team = fendor
access_code = ac_bb00ea
host = jorox.qorveltech.internal
port = 9200
owner = istdor.aldeth
peer = julvan.orvexlabs.internal

Runbook: Veriflux validator plugins. Support team — when a customer reports a validation rule "not firing," first check whether the relevant plugin is loaded. Plugins live in the registry and are enabled per-tenant; a disabled plugin fails silently by design. Restarting the worker reloads the plugin manifest. Do not edit plugin code — escalate to the Quillbrook platform team instead. Logs tag each validation with the plugin name and version. The loader reads the configuration values listed below.

settings of kajep-kawip:
[zorys]
host = zorys.urlaqgrid.corp
user = zorys_svc
database = zorys_prod